The Ministry of Health, sometimes abbreviated to MOH, is the ministry responsible for the health of the citizens of Saudi Arabia. The current minister is Dr. Tawfig AlRabiah and has held the position since May 2016. The Minister's responsibilities is to manage healthcare for the citizens of Saudi Arabia. This involves the strategy for public health in the country, while also managing crucial health infrastructure.
